The Impact of Brief Interventions on Functioning Among those Demonstrating Anxiety, Depressive, and Adjustment Disorder Symptoms in Primary Care: The Effectiveness of the Primary Care Behavioral Health (PCBH) Model
Abstract
Objective: The high prevalence of anxiety, depression, and adjustment disorders are tied to deleterious individual, fiscal, and organizational consequences. A growing method of treatment is the integration of behavioral health providers into the primary care setting, where half of individuals already present to seek care. Primary Care Behavioral Health (PCBH) is one model of treatment in which behavioral health consultants (BHC) work directly with primary care providers to enhance a holistic approach to health care in a primary care clinic.
